This book is very easy to understand and shows you an excellent way to learn matlab on your own. This will get you a list of books, including neural networks design. Based on the tutorial guide to matlab written by dr. Demonstration programs from the book are used in various chapters of this guide. Octave programming tutorial wikibooks, open books for an. You may extend the chapter by doing your own experiments with the system. Matlab introduction zmatlab is a program for doing numerical computation. Download ebooks for free from engineering study material site. Best book for beginners matlab answers matlab central. Therefore, the best way to learn is by trying it yourself. This site is like a library, you could find million book here by using search box in the header. Click download or read online button to get computational fourier optics a matlab tutorial book now. This book instead takes a hybrid approach, introducing both the programming and the efficient uses. Variables in a script file are global and will change the % value of variables of the same name in the environment of the current.
This book gives an introduction to basic neural network architectures and. Check your calculus book, if you have forgotten what. Whether you are a math student, researcher, teacher, engineer or scientist this book covers the inandout of the essentials you. A good example matrix, used throughout this book, appears. The texts present theory, realworld examples, and exercises using matlab, simulink, and other mathworks products. Computational fourier optics a matlab tutorial download. Matlab is an interactive system whose basic data element is an array that does not require. Practice gui figfiles and mfiles in guide, save the graphical layout to a fig file note.
Revision history november 2000 online only new for matlab 6. A small tribute to netaji on 23rd january using ma. Heres the best matlab tutorials, best matlab books and best matlab courses to help you learn matlab in 2020. The purpose of this tutorial is to familiarize the beginner to matlab, by introducing the basic features and commands of the program. It is in no way a complete reference and the reader is encouraged to further enhance his or her knowledge of matlab by reading some of the suggested references at the end of this guide. This page contains list of freely available e books, online textbooks and tutorials in matlab. The best way to learn is by experimentation, and the best way this tutorial can help you is by telling you the basics and giving you directions towards which you can take off exploring on your own. Matlab matlab is a software package for doing numerical computation. Each chapter of the manual represents one tutorial, and includes exercises to be done during private study time. Spencer department of physics and astronomy brigham young university c 2000 ross l. To run this tutorial under matlab, just type notebook tutorial. Matlab det matematisknaturvitenskapelige fakultet, uio. Starting matlab for pcs, matlab should be a program. It is used for freshmen classes at northwestern university.
Chapter 3, introduction introduces matlab and the matlab desktop. Paul schrimpf matlab objectoriented programming january 14, 2009 4 15 example. Matlab vectorization is a way of computing in which an operation is performed simultaneously on a list. Pdf neural networks matlab toolbox manual hasan abbasi. If youre looking for a free download links of matlab for engineers 4th edition pdf, epub, docx and torrent then this site is not for you. For a more comprehensive view we recommend the book matlab guide 2nd ed.
Educational technology consultant mit academic computing. This tutorial gives you aggressively a gentle introduction of matlab programming. This paper is an introduction to matlab for econometrics. Once there, you can obtain sample book chapters in pdf format and you can download the transparency masters by clicking transparency. Global global speedoflight shared by functions, scripts, and base workspace. The rst one sends a cop yofy our graph directly to the. Control engineering an introduction with the use of matlab. For each tutorial you should read through the relevant chapter, trying out the various features of matlabwhich are described, and then you should do the exercises. This site is like a library, use search box in the widget to get ebook that you want. The matlab command that allows you to do this is called notebook. Your contribution will go a long way in helping us. A brief introduction to matlab stanford university. Download matlab gnu octave tutorial book pdf free download link or read online here in pdf.
It describes the matlab desktop, contains a sample matlab session showing elementary matlab operations, gives details of data inputoutput. Introduction to matlab programming data structures indexing cell arrays i one important concept. It is appropriate for undergraduate and graduate courses in matlab, as a reference in courses where matlab is used, or as a selfstudy reference. Neural network design martin hagan oklahoma state university. Learn matlab and become a a confident matlab programmer.
Download free books at control engineering 11 introduction 1. This matlab tutorial starts from the very begining and requires no prior programming. We assume that the students have no prior experience with matlab. Matlab i about the tutorial matlab is a programming language developed by mathworks. It was originally designed for solving linear algebra type problems using matrices. Check our section of free e books and guides on matlab now. The everincreasing number of books based on mathworks products reflects the widespread use of these tools for research and development. Matlab tutorial, march 26, 2004 j gadewadikar, automation and robotics research institute university of texas at arlington 36 how to explore it more. It started out as a matrix programming language where linear algebra programming was simple. Spencer and brigham young university this is a tutorial to help you get started in matlab.
Modeling and simulation using matlab simulink, 2ed 2. All books are in clear copy here, and all files are secure so dont worry about it. Download digital image processing using matlab pdf ebook. Matlab documentat ion is also available in printed form and in pdf format. Matlab is a commercial matrix laboratory package, by mathworks, which operates as an interactive programming environment with graphical output. Browse and download matlab books of various titles, written by many authors and published by a number of publications for free in pdf format. Paul smith september 2005 this document provides an introduction to computing using octave. Review some basics of linear algebra essential for geometry of points and lines. The aim of this book is to help the student to be familiar with matlab. Many slides today adapted from octavia camps, penn state. From this link, you can obtain sample book chapters in pdf format and you. We assume a basiclevel knowledge and address to official documentation.
About the tutorial matlab is a programming language developed by mathworks. This book provides an introduction to some of the most useful features of matlab. The close compatibility of the opensource octave1 package with matlab2, which. It will teach you howto use octave to perform calculations, plot graphs, and write simple programs. Throughout this tutorial we will give you an overview of various things and refer you to matlabs online help for more information. A practical time series tutorial with matlab michalis vlachos ibm t. Depending on the info reader you are using to navigate this tutorial, you might be able to cut and. Persistent persistent r, c can be declared and used only in functions. Working through the examples will give you a feel for the way that matlab operates.
The matlab programming language is exceptionally straightforward since almost every data object is assumed to be an array. You should record the outcome of the commands and experiments in a notebook. Its a very good coverage of the basics, more advanced topics with plenty of trial examples at the end of each chapter and is a great book which presents programming concepts and matlab. Author includes plenty of examples, the best way to learn to use matlab is to read this while running matlab, trying the examples and experimenting. As its name implies control engineering involves the design of an engineering product or system where a requirement is to accurately control some quantity, say the temperature in a room or the position or speed of an electric. The second way to use the toolbox is through basic commandline operations.
S997 introduction to matlab programming, including video lectures. Read online matlab gnu octave tutorial book pdf free download link book now. It provides a convenient command line interface for solving linear and nonlinear problems numerically, and for performing other numerical experiments using a language that is mostly compatible with matlab. In editordebugger, create mfiles one mfile for every gui window one mfile for every callback function that is executed when the user interacts with widgets.
Quick introduction to matlab part i pdf quick introduction to matlab part ii pdf matlab tutorial for calculus iii includes symbolic computations matlab tutorial from university of dundee pdf tutorials offered by mathworks free downloadable books on matlab. Matlab is a programming language developed by mathworks. Octave is a highlevel language, primarily intended for numerical computations. Matlab commands for you to type are printed in bold letters.
If you are running on a unix machine, you can also run matlab in any xterm window, but you will miss the advanced interface options that makes the new versions of matlab such a pleasure to deal with. Free matlab books download ebooks online textbooks tutorials. Matlab a practical introduction to programming and problem solving is exclusively designed for matlab beginners. Parallel computing with matlab university of sheffield. Deep learning toolbox provides a framework for designing and implementing deep neural networks with algorithms, pretrained models, and apps.
Neural network toolbox 5 users guide 400 bad request. In this document ive complied 10 matlab programs from basic to advanced through intermediate levels, but overall they are for beginners. We would like to show you a description here but the site wont allow us. Programming with matlab is a stepbystep comprehensive guide that equips your skills in matlab.
If youre looking for a free download links of digital image processing using matlab pdf, epub, docx and torrent then this site is not for you. Chapter 4, matrices and arrays introduces matrices and arrays, how to enter and generate them, how to operate on them, and how to control command window input and output. A nbym cell array is made up of n m, 1by1 cell arrays, i two ways to index into and assign into a cell array. A practical introduction to programming and problem solvingbook. This course was offered as a noncredit program during the independent activities period iap, january 2008. The matlab online help provides taskoriented and reference information about matlab features. It is heavily optimized for vector operationsgood good for fast calculations on vectors and matricesbad bad if you can not state your problem as a vector. It can be run both under interactive sessions and as a batch job. Matlab matrix laboratory is a multiparadigm numerical computing environment and fourthgeneration programming language which is frequently. The tutorial is designed for students using either the professional version of matlab ver. This book is printed on acidfree paper containing 10% postconsumer waste. Network toolbox is used to learn the parameters in the network, when input.
Matlab gnu octave tutorial pdf book manual free download. This tutorial gives you aggressively a gentle introduction of matlab programming language. Programming assignments in this course will almost exclusively be performed in matlab, a widelyused environment for technical computing with a focus on matrix operations. Scripts share local variables with functions they call and with the base workspace. Introduction to matlab for engineering students is a document for an introductory course note in matlab and technical computing.
Delft university of technology september 2006 faculty of electrical engineering, mathematics and computer science matlab manual it is forbidden to copy or abuse software and documentation supplied by the faculty of. Simpsons algorithm for numerical integration using. Electric machines and power systems 16 editing mfile through editor window use the editordebugger to create and debug mfiles, which are programs you write to run matlab functions. This package is based on a server program running on the board, which listens to commands arriving via serial port, executes the commands, and, if needed, returns a result. This document is not a comprehensive introduction or a reference manual. Download matlab for engineers 4th edition pdf ebook. It covers all the primary matlab features at a high level, including many examples. Mastering matlab covers the essential aspects of matlab presented in an easy tofollow learn while doing tutorial format. All content included on our site, such as text, images, digital downloads and other, is the property of its content suppliers and protected by us and international laws. Trapezoid rule for numerical integration using mat. Getting started with matlab by rudra pratap in chm, rtf, txt download e book. Powerpoint format or pdf for each chapter are available on the web at. You can find all the book demonstration programs in the neural network.
Short matlab tutorial and cool matlab demos by mathworks. About the tutorial matlab tutorial matlab is a programming language developed by mathworks. It focuses on the specific features of matlab that are useful for engineering classes. Getting started with matlab free pdf, chm, rtf, txt. You can obtain sample book chapters in pdf format as well. Watson research center hawthorne, ny, 10532 tutorial timeseries with matlab 2 about this tutorial the goal of this tutorial is to show you that timeseries research or research in general can be made fun, when it involves visualizing ideas, that can be achieved with. The challenge for students is that it is nearly impossible to predict whether they will in fact need to know programming concepts later on or whether a software package such as matlab will suffice for their careers.